What You Will Be Doing:
- Complete all departmental project activities accurately in accordance with ICON SOPs, Project Specific Procedures, regulatory requirements, and Sponsors processes
- Provide administrative support to project teams as required
- Distribute safety reports to Sponsors (our clients), their sites, and applicable ICON personnel in accordance with Standard Operating Procedures and Project Specific Procedures
- Coordinate setup of required systems and mailboxes during study startup (mailboxes, distribution lists, shared drives, tracking tools, etc.)
- File all documents within allotted timeframes, including maintenance of project mailboxes and maintenance of TMF and E-TMF, including performing quality control checks
- Maintain data entry for safety event and miscellaneous tracking logs for all current projects
- Assist with organization and planning of meetings (room planning, set-up, and attendee logistics), including preparation and distribution of presentations, agendas, and meeting minutes, as requested.
- Daily entry into, and maintenance of, appropriate tracking systems (e.g. SAE/safety event tracking systems)
- Maintain project training records for all assigned project team members
- Handle Safety Reporting courier submissions to Competent Authorities and Ethics Committees and acknowledges receipt in Safety Reporting System
- Updating and maintenance of project database information systems
- Perform regular testing of fax numbers and e-mail addresses as required
- Maintenance, coordination and updates of shared and validated documentation repositories
- Coordination of translation of documents for projects
- Completion of monthly metrics
- Handling requests for literature and articles
- Assistance with audit schedules and arrangement, including preparation of documents
- Assist with generation/distribution of project specific procedures
- Support QPPV, including PSMF activities as required
- Attend project team and Sponsor meetings as required
- Able to lead and mentor other team members (more Senior Admin roles).
